Mexican actress and singer Thalía shared a message on her Facebook account to make clear she is not a supporter of Republican presidential nominee Donald Trump.
“Let me be 100 percent very clear about this, I am not a supporter and never would be a supporter of Donald Trump. I have never been a supporter of his campaign or anyone for that matter, who has such bad feelings and ill-fated intentions toward my country.” Thalía wrote.
She also said “I am a Mexican woman, and very proud of it. Anyone who speaks of my people in that way offends me in the highest regard and by the way, everyone in my country as well. Once again, I would like to emphasize that I have not and will never be a supporter of DONALD Trump.”
Last week, several media outlets published a photo of Thalía posing next to a helicopter of Donald Trump, which sparked controversy.
“In December 2014, I flew on the helicopter that appears in the photo that several media outlets have published. This was way BEFORE Donald Trump announced his candidacy for president of the United States.” she added.
